Court orders Sanwo-Olu’s paramour Aisha Achimugu to forfeit N4.6 billion jewellery, 11 exotic cars, $50,000 to FG

Published

on

The Abuja Division of the Federal High Court has granted the final forfeiture of property linked to the Lagos State Governor, Babajide Sanwo-Olu’s paramour, Aisha Achimugu, to the federal government.

The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C), in a statement on Thursday, announced that Mrs Achimugu’s assets forfeited to the Federal Government include “jewellery worth N4,645,170,294.9, eleven exotic cars worth N4,293,000,000, and $50,000 cash.”

According to the anti-graft agency, Justice Jude Onwugbuzie granted the order on Thursday, July 16, 2026, in a judgment on the application for the final forfeiture of the property by the anti-graft commission.

In March, same court ordered final forfeiture of $13 million linked to Mrs Achimugu’s Oceangate Engineering Oil & Gas Ltd.
